7.5Walter Gruber once belonged to a group of unscrupulous, money-grubbing poachers. Now released from prison, he is determined never to touch a gun again. He was imprisoned for poaching, but they couldn't prove he fired the shot that wounded forester Kuhnert. Upon his return home, Walter is horrified to discover that his former lover, Kuhnert's daughter Grete, has since married someone else. Grete still loves Walter, with whom she was pregnant. But her father would have made life a living hell for her and the child had she not married another man. This man, Robert Thiele, is still poaching and is extremely ruthless in his methods. Robert eventually blackmails Walter into rejoining the poachers. When the gang shoots the old forester Kuhnert, Robert shifts suspicion onto Walter.
